sql >> Database >  >> RDS >> Mysql

Navicat voor MySQL

Als u te maken heeft gehad met uitdagingen met betrekking tot MySQL/MariaDB-beheer en/of -ontwikkeling en dringend een ideale oplossing nodig heeft, zoek dan niet verder dan Navicat voor MySQL. Met Navicat voor MySQL als een enkele applicatie, is het eenvoudig en gelijktijdig maken van een MySQL- of MariaDB-databaseverbinding.

Navicat voor MySQL deelt geweldige compatibiliteit met clouddatabase-infrastructuren zoals Microsoft Azure, Oracle Cloud, Amazon RDS, Google Cloud en Amazon Aurora. Als u op zoek bent naar een betrouwbare oplossing voor het beheren, ontwikkelen en onderhouden van databases, dan is het all-inclusive frontend-karakter van Navicat voor MySQL intuïtief en grafisch krachtig genoeg om de klus te klaren.

Deze oplossing voor databasebeheer is toepasbaar en wordt ondersteund door populaire besturingssysteemomgevingen zoals Windows, macOS, Linux en iOS.

Navicat voor MySQL-systeemvereisten

Als u deze databasebeheer-app op uw computer wilt hebben, moet u aan de volgende systeemvereisten voldoen.

Windows: Server 2019, Server 2012, Server 2016, Server 2008, Windows 10, Windows 8, Windows 8.1, Windows 7, Microsoft Windows Vista.

macOS: macOS 10.15 Catalina, macOS 10.13 ig Sierra, Mac OS X 10.11 El Capitan, macOS 10.14 Mojave, macOS 10.12 Sierra.

Linux: Linux Mint 18 of nieuwere versie, Fedora 26 of nieuwere versie, CentOS 7 of nieuwere versie, Ubuntu 16.04 of nieuwere versie, Debian 9 of latere versie.

U kunt een proefversie van Navicat downloaden via de volgende link met betrekking tot de OS-omgeving van uw keuze. Als je je wilt abonneren of een van de abonnementen wilt kopen, volg dan deze link.

Voor Linux-gebruikers, als je eenmaal de app-image van deze databasebeheer-app op je computer hebt gedownload, moet je deze eerst uitvoerbaar maken voordat je hem probeert. Raadpleeg de volgende stappen nadat u het hebt gedownload:

$ chmod +x navicat15-mysql-en.AppImage
$ ./navicat15-mysql-en.AppImage

Navicat voor MySQL belangrijkste UI-kenmerken

Als we tot slot kijken naar de UI-interactie van Navicat voor MySQL geïnstalleerd op een Linux-omgeving, kunt u de volgende functionele UI-displays tegenkomen.

Hoofdscherm

De GUI voor databasebeheer en -ontwikkeling voor Navicat is eenvoudig, intuïtief en goed ontworpen voor een betere gezichtsscherpte.

Objectontwerper

De schermafbeelding is een UI-weergave van hoe goed een slimme objectontwerper geïnitieerde databaseobjecten beheert of verwerkt.

Gegevensmanipulatie

U kunt met een vergelijkbare spreadsheetachtige gegevenseditor werken. Gegevensinvoertaken via invoeg-, bewerkings-, verwijderings- en/of kopieer-/plakfuncties zijn gemakkelijk haalbaar.

Modelleren

De gebruikte databasemodellerings- en ontwerptool is geavanceerd genoeg om het bewerken en visualiseren van botdatabases aan te kunnen.

Grafieken en grafieken

Met grafieken en grafieken als onderdeel van dit applicatiepakket voor databasebeheer, krijgt u duidelijkere gegevensinzichten zodra de databasegegevens waarmee u werkt, zijn omgezet in beelden.

Gegevenssynchronisatie

Als u eenmaal gewend bent aan Navicat voor MySQL, zult u merken dat u tegelijkertijd met meer dan één database of schema werkt. Gegevenssynchronisatie zorgt voor een beter en gedetailleerder analyseproces in termen van gegevensvergelijking en synchroniciteit.

Structuursynchronisatie

Structuursynchroniciteit is van toepassing op een databasegebruiker of beheerder die een volledig vergelijkend beeld krijgt van de actieve databases. U kunt ook scripts genereren die nuttig zijn bij het bijwerken van gerichte databasebestemmingen.

Code voltooid

De bovenstaande schermafbeelding demonstreert de effectiviteit van de SQL-editor van Navicat bij het voltooien van code tijdens het construeren van SQL-instructies. U hoeft niet al uw constructies van SQL-instructies te onthouden, aangezien er een vervolgkeuzelijst wordt gegeven met verschillende optionele suggesties om uw instructies te voltooien.

Codefragment

Met de SQL-editor van Navicat kunt u ook een SQL-codefragment naar keuze in zijn omgeving invoegen. Deze functionele flexibiliteit is voordelig omdat uw SQL-schrijven sneller en foutloos zal zijn.

Automatisering

Soms vereisen uw databasebeheerroutines dat u aan omvangrijke dagelijkse taken werkt. Met Navicat voor MySQL kunnen batchtaken worden gemaakt en gepland. Het automatiseert de uitvoering van deze taken tot hun voltooiing. U kunt ook e-mailmeldingen ontvangen zodra deze taken hun mijlpaaldoelstellingen hebben bereikt.

Navicat-cloud

Met Navicat Cloud is samenwerking mogelijk via teamleden op afstand. Dit komt omdat uw databasebestanden een centrale opslaglocatie hebben waar elk teamlid toegang toe heeft, aangezien ze over de benodigde toegangsauthenticatie en autorisatie beschikken.

Navicat voor MySQL app-functies

Nu je een glimp hebt opgevangen van hoe de gebruikersinterface van Navicat voor MySQL eruitziet, is het tijd om enkele van de belangrijkste functies te benadrukken waarmee je zou moeten communiceren zodra je deze databasetoepassing gaat gebruiken.

Naadloze gegevensmigratie

De enige manier voor een databasebeheerder om minder overhead te realiseren, is door snellere en eenvoudigere gegevensmigratie. De laatste verklaring kan worden geïmplementeerd door middel van gegevenssynchronisatie, gegevensoverdracht en structuursynchronisatie. Gegevensoverdracht tussen of naar andere databases is niet alleen gedetailleerd, maar volgt ook een stapsgewijze richtlijn.

Structuur- en gegevenssynchronisatie helpt u bij het vergelijken en synchroniseren van uw databases. De implementatie plus het instellen van deze vergelijkingen duurt meestal seconden. Er wordt ook een gedetailleerd script gegenereerd met details van de databasewijzigingen die gepland zijn voor uitvoering.

Gediversifieerde manipulatietool

Op een bepaald moment in uw zoektocht naar databasebeheer, zult u merken dat u te maken krijgt met verschillende gegevensformaten. Om dergelijke gegevensindelingen over te zetten, hebt u de functionaliteit van de importwizard van Navicat nodig. Uw imports kunnen ook van ODBC zijn zodra er een haalbare gegevensbronverbinding bestaat of correct is ingesteld.

Gegevensexport is van toepassing op queryresultaten, weergaven of tabellen. De ondersteunde exportformaten omvatten CSV, Access, Excel en nog veel meer. Navicat biedt een spreadsheetachtige rasterweergave voor het eenvoudig toevoegen, wijzigen en verwijderen van records. Ook worden uw gegevensbewerkingen verzorgd door een verscheidenheid aan beschikbare en betrouwbare gegevensbewerkingstools. Dergelijke Navicat-tools vereenvoudigen en stimuleren uw gegevensbeheerroutines om efficiënter te zijn.

Uw databasebeheerervaring wordt beperkt door een soepel overgangsproces.

Eenvoudige SQL-bewerking

Het maken, bewerken en uitvoeren van SQL-instructies is flexibel mogelijk via Navicat's Visual SQL Builder. Deze tool verwijdert semantische en syntaxisfouten die verband houden met het juiste gebruik van SQL-opdrachten. Het bestaan ​​van aanpasbare codefragmenten en functionaliteiten voor het aanvullen van code gaan ook gepaard met zoekwoordsuggesties en een functie die repetitieve code op uw SQL-instructies verwijdert.

Intelligente databaseontwerper

Navicat voor MySQL wordt geleverd met professionele objectontwerpers. Ze helpen bij het maken, wijzigen en beheren van databaseobjecten. Zijn verfijning strekt zich ook uit tot database-ontwerp- en modelleringsfunctionaliteiten die helpen bij het creëren van ideale grafische representaties van geconverteerde databases. Het verkrijgen van inzicht in complexe databases is mogelijk na hun modellerings- en creatiestappen.

Gegevensvisualisatietool

Er is voor een databasebeheerder niets vervelender dan het omgaan met de complexiteit van grote datasets. Met datavisualisatietools zoals grafieken in het spel, hebben grote datasets een betere visuele weergave, wat leidt tot betere en diepere data-inzichten. Gegevensrelaties, trends en patronen zijn gemakkelijk te onderzoeken en bloot te leggen. Dit resultaat leidt tot het creëren van effectieve visuele output die kan worden gedeeld op een dashboard voor presentatiedoeleinden.

Verhoogde productiviteit

Met een lokale back-up-/hersteloplossing als krachtige backbone voor deze database-app, profiteren de gebruikers van de administratieve database van een begeleid back-upproces. Deze aanpak voorkomt dat veel gebruikers te maken krijgen met mogelijke fouten. Aangezien scriptuitvoeringen en databaseback-ups kwalificeren als repetitieve implementatieprocessen, kunnen dergelijke taken worden geautomatiseerd door de tijd en datum op te geven.

Dergelijke database-georiënteerde doelstellingen zijn ook op afstand haalbaar. U hoeft niet fysiek aanwezig te zijn om deze taken uit te voeren.

Eenvoudig samenwerken

Deze database-app wordt geleverd met een Navicat-cloudservice. Het helpt bij het synchroniseren van virtuele groepen, query's, modellen en verbindingsinstellingen. Databasebeheerders hebben gemakkelijk realtime toegang tot deze hulpprogramma's voor databasefuncties. Het delen van deze functietools en functionaliteiten met collega's is eenvoudig en ongeacht de tijdzone of geografische locatie van de databasebeheerder of beoogde gebruikers.

Kortom, de Navicat Cloud-service maximaliseert de productiviteit van gebruikers en systemen en maakt tegelijkertijd gebruik van de tijd die nodig is om de benodigde databasefunctionaliteiten te implementeren en uit te voeren.

Geavanceerde beveiligde verbinding

Navicat voor MySQL brengt zijn verbindingen tot stand via SSL- en SSH-tunneling voor betrouwbare, veilige en stabiele verbindingen. Omdat communicerende databaseservers authenticatie nodig hebben, is de ondersteuning van Navicat voor netwerkauthenticatiemethodologieën zoals PAM-authenticatie aanzienlijk. Er bestaan ​​meer dan één authenticatiemechanisme in een Navicat-omgeving.

In het laatste geval is de omgeving zeer performant, zodat de gebruikers zich geen zorgen hoeven te maken over het werken onder een onveilige netwerkverbinding.

Cross-platform licenties

Navicat voor MySQL geeft niet om uw besturingssysteemvoorkeur, omdat het dynamisch genoeg is om alle geïnteresseerde gebruikers te bedienen. De platformonafhankelijke licentie is van toepassing op Linux-, macOS- en Windows-gebruikers. Zodra u een succesvolle aankoop of abonnement op Navicat heeft gedaan, vereist uw ideale besturingssysteemplatform de activering en toekomstige overdracht van de licentie.

Donkere modus

Als ervaren databasebeheerder of als u uw vaardigheden op het gebied van databasebeheer via Navicat voor MySQL kunt uitbreiden, is één ding duidelijk:u zult het grootste deel van uw tijd achter een beeldscherm of monitor doorbrengen. Wat de gezondheid betreft, kunnen dergelijke omstandigheden hinderlijk zijn voor het zicht van uw ogen, maar niet wanneer u Navicat gebruikt voor de MySQL-database-app.

De donkere modusfunctie heeft een donkere themafunctionaliteit die het menselijk oog beschermt tegen verblindende witheid die zichtbaar is in traditionele computerschermen. Deze functie in de donkere modus verandert niets aan uw weergave of weergave van gegevens. Uw paginaweergaven zien er nog steeds hetzelfde uit.

Laatste opmerking

Navicat voor MySQL is een toverstaf voor databasebeheer die wordt geleverd met talloze trucs en flexibele functiefuncties. De GUI is interactief genoeg samen met zijn visuele uitrusting. U kunt complexe query's eenvoudig afhandelen via grafieken en grafieken en u hoeft zich geen zorgen te maken over het plannen van back-uproutines. Navicat heeft te veel te bieden. De opmerkelijke toepasbaarheid is waarom bedrijven als Toshiba, Alcatel, Alsco, Yahoo, Intel en instellingen als Stanford en de Universiteit van Oxford er geen genoeg van kunnen krijgen.


  1. Django-databaselaag gebruiken buiten Django?

  2. Weet iemand welke coderingstechniek JDeveloper/SQL Developer gebruikt om inloggegevens te behouden?

  3. Database-indexering in een notendop met B+tree en Hash in vergelijking

  4. MySQL WORDT alleen lid van de meest recente rij?